    Default Incoming Call Problems - Rogers Network

    Hiyo, recently got a package addon which includes "call display + voice mail + who called" well the phone had everything but who called (which lets me know if my phone is off, who calls via an sms when i turn the phone back on) and well since i got that addon i dont recive any calls. The phone doesnt ring and im guessing the call is directed to voicemail and i recive a txt stating the number of the call missed.

    i was reading that this has happend to some ppl on the fido network but it happens with caller id? and well my caller id has worked really well.

    any help would be much appreciated.

    if anything i might need to cancle the "who called" feature but i dont really wanna. lol.

    The who called feature is a text message that is sent AFTER every call you miss. It's by far the most annoying feature ever created, and for some reason the A1200 won't ring if the feature is enabled. Caller ID works just fine.
